FASHION FORWARD



The A/W 14-15 runways were all about fur, feathers and general fuzzy fabulousness; but fizzed up in popping shades of fuchsia, neon and tangerine (think scarlet shearling at Prada and dusky rose goathair at Gucci). For a pretty take on the trend, look to this stripy stole in fluffy blush from ASOS, or the colour-block version in indigo and baby blue for a high-street hit of fashion-pack favourite Shrimps’ clashing colourways. If you’re feeling brave, these sumptuous sheepskin cuffs or Urbancode earmuffs in magenta marabou are the last word in bold brights; and the ultimate way to cheer up that boring black ensemble on the trudge to another 9AM!
Poodle-pink earmuffs a bit Barbie-girl for you? (Though that look is hot right now, see Moschino S/S 2015…) If you’re still not sold on Shrimps, buy into next season’s Seventies styles to fight the winter chill. Push the preppy angle with this Prada-lookalike pullover from Nasty Gal; or slip on this folk-fringe lovely from Scandi-brand Monki for a hint of Pucci-esque hippie-chic.
